Vonovia S.E. Form 8937 Attachment
On 12 July 2017, GAGFAH S.A. ("GAGFAH"), a Société Anonyme organized under the laws of Luxembourg, was merged with and into Vonovia S.E. ("Vonovia"), a Societas Europaea organized under the laws of the European Union, with Vonovia surviving and GAGFAH ceasing to exist (the "Merger"). At the effective time of the Merger, each issued and outstanding share of GAGFAH was cancelled and (other than shares of GAGFAH held by Vonovia) automatically converted into the right to receive 0.57 shares of Vonovia and cash in lieu of fractional Vonovia shares.
The issuer cannot provide tax advice; shareholders are urged to consult their own tax advisors regarding the particular consequences of the Merger, including the applicability and effect of all U.S. federal, state and local, and foreign tax laws.
The Merger qualifies as a "reorganization" under Internal Revenue Code Section 368(a)(1)(A). Accordingly, U.S. shareholders of GAGFAH will generally not be subject to U.S. federal income tax as a result of the exchange of GAGFAH shares for Vonovia shares except in connection with cash received in lieu of fractional shares (discussed above). A U.S. shareholder's aggregate tax basis in the Vonovia shares received in the Merger generally will equal the U.S. shareholder's aggregate tax basis in the GAGFAH shares surrendered in exchange therefor. An illustrative example is provided below.
The adjusted tax basis of Vonovia shares received in the Merger will be the adjusted tax basis of GAGFAH shares exchanged therefor, adjusted to reflect to the exchange ratio used in the Merger. As discussed above, the effect of the Merger is that each GAGFAH share is exchanged for 0.57 Vonovia shares, less the tax basis allocated to the portion of the shares of GAGFAH shares attributable to cash received in lieu of fractional Vonovia shares.
The following example illustrates the method for a GAGFAH shareholder to calculate her basis in Vonovia shares as a consequence of the Merger. This example is meant to be illustrative only. The issuer cannot provide tax advice; shareholders are strongly encouraged to consult their own tax advisors regarding the particular consequences of the Merger, including the applicability and effect of all U.S. federal, state and local, and foreign tax laws.
Example: Prior to the Merger, Shareholder owns 1,000 GAGFAH shares, with an adjusted basis of \$100 per share, for an aggregate basis of \$100,000. Shareholder does not actually or constructively own any Vonovia shares other than the Vonovia shares that she will receive in connection with the Merger.
In connection with the Merger, she exchanges all 1,000 of her GAGFAH shares for 570 Vonovia shares (1,000 x 0.57). She allocates her \$100,000 aggregate basis to the 570 Vonovia shares (minus whatever amount received for any fractional Vonovia shares). Thus, Shareholder takes a basis in each Vonovia share of approximately \$175.44.
Internal Revenue Code Sections 358 and 368.
See Line 15 (gain or loss generally not recognized except in connection with cash received in lieu of fractional shares).
The Merger was executed on 12 July 2017. For a GAGFAH shareholder whose taxable year is a calendar year, the reportable tax year is 2017.
